Bilal El Khannouss is now on Newcastle’s radar. In search of an attacking reinforcement, the English club is considering the possibility of recruiting the Moroccan international from Stuttgart, while negotiations regarding Matias Fernandez-Pardo remain complicated.
The 22-year-old midfielder is seen by the Magpies as a genuine alternative to the Lille player. However, Newcastle has yet to submit any official offer to the German club, which is particularly demanding in this matter.
Initially inclined to spend another season at Stuttgart to compete in the Champions League, El Khannouss is now open to a return to the Premier League. The prospect of joining Newcastle and returning to a league he already knows would particularly appeal to the Moroccan.
However, Stuttgart does not intend to facilitate his departure. The German club recently rejected a €22 million proposal from Galatasaray and is reportedly asking for a higher amount. Newcastle will therefore need to make a significant financial effort if it decides to pursue its interest.
